Common Residential & Commercial Roofing Scams in Brandy Camp
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Storm Chaser Scam
Fly-by-night crews flood in after bad weather, demand big deposits, do shoddy work, or disappear. They prey on fear with tales of 'imminent collapse'.
Bait-and-Switch
Ultra-low initial quote to hook you, then 'discover' extra damage needing more cash midway.
Substandard Materials
Promise premium shingles but swap for cheap ones, pocketing the difference.
Phantom Damage
Invent leaks or issues to sell unnecessary full replacements.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Demand a certificate of insurance for li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er to verify it's active and lists you as additional insured.
Licensing
Pennsylvania requires no statewide roofing license, but local permits are mandatory. Contact Elk County Building Department or Brandy Camp Borough to confirm they handle permits. Check PA Attorney General's registry for complaints.
References
Ask for 3-5 recent local references in Elk County. Call them to check work quality, arrival time, and cleanup.
